Output 84c1bb645493299c426c1b7a924480be7044f03dee39e95144319b5cc828c06e:1

value
22576000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9336f2785cdc615fadacbb7baa86459bc0756ac5 OP_EQUAL
address
A5rfpPCtWZH6VVQGWd7hBMCTCFgEHe5CBW
transaction
84c1bb645493299c426c1b7a924480be7044f03dee39e95144319b5cc828c06e